摘要: select @@autocommit; -- 查询自动提交 set autocommit=0; -- 关闭自动提交0 1开启 select @@tx_isolation; -- 查询隔离级别 set session transaction isolation level read committe 阅读全文
posted @ 2020-07-15 18:15 K____K 阅读(361) 评论(0) 推荐(0) 编辑
摘要: 数据库事务的隔离级别有4种,由低到高分别为Read uncommitted 、Read committed 、Repeatable read 、Serializable 。而且,在事务的并发操作中可能会出现脏读,不可重复读,幻读。下面通过事例一一阐述它们的概念与联系。 Read uncommitte 阅读全文
posted @ 2020-07-15 17:03 K____K 阅读(116) 评论(0) 推荐(0) 编辑
摘要: 面试官:小伙子,给我说一下mysql 乐观锁和悲观锁吧 悲观锁介绍 悲观锁,正如其名,它指的是对数据被外界(包括本系统当前的其他事务,以及来自外部系统的事务处理)修改持保守态度,因此,在整个数据处理过程中, 将数据处于锁定状态。悲观锁的实现,往往依靠数据库提供的锁机制(也只有数据库层提供的锁机制才能 阅读全文
posted @ 2020-07-15 15:20 K____K 阅读(213) 评论(0) 推荐(0) 编辑